About Lohri

Lohri marks the end of winter and the harvesting of rabi crops. A bonfire is lit at sunset; people dance bhangra around it and throw sesame, jaggery, puffed rice, and popcorn into the flames.

Traditions & Customs

  • Bonfire lighting
  • Bhangra & Giddha
  • Sesame til offerings
  • Rewri & peanuts
  • Songs for newborns & newlyweds
